About This Item
New York: Grosset & Dunlap, 1931. Hardcover. Very Good +. [8], 267 p., color frontispiece; 21 cm. Dark blue cloth with silver spine and cover title; blind-stamped illustration of a dog's head on front cover. Top page edges dark blue. Illustrated endpapers. Clipping with information about the author on half title page. Shadow from former clipping on back of title page and dedication page. In Very Good+ Condition: other than the noted clipping shadow, clean and bright.
